The Effect of Rootone F Concentration and Planting Media Composition on the Growth of Fig (Ficus carica L.) Cuttings Intan Febriana Samodro; Sutini Sutini; Ramdan Hidayat

Abstract

Fig cuttings often face problems with failure of the roots to grow from the cuttings, so efforts are needed to encourage root induction by administering auxin growth regulators. Rootone F is an exogenous PGR from the auxin group which can stimulate root growth. In order for the roots to grow, develop and function well, plants need an ideal planting medium. The ideal planting medium to support good growth of plant seeds is a proportional composition of physical, chemical and biological elements. The aim of the research was to examine the combined effect of Rootone F concentration and planting media composition on the vegetative growth of fig cuttings. The research consisted of two treatment factors, namely the concentration of Rootone F (0 ppm (Control), 100 ppm, 150 ppm and 200 ppm) and the composition of the planting media (soil: husk charcoal: cow manure) with a ratio (1:1:1), (2:1:1), and (3:1:1). The best treatment combination is 150 ppm Rootone F and planting media mixed with soil: roasted husks: organic cow fertilizer with a ratio of 3:1:1 which has a significant effect on shoot length, root length, fresh weight of roots and percentage of live cuttings (%). A concentration of 100 ppm Rootone F gave the best results when the first shoots appeared (DAT), a concentration of 150 ppm Rootone F gave the best results on the number of leaves. A planting medium composition of (3:1:1) gives the best results when the first shoots appear (DAT).   Keywords: Auxin, Growth regulator, Influence, Nutrient, Vegetative.
Effect of Seed Bulb Cutting Size and Planting Media Volume on the Growth and Yield of Shallot (Allium ascalonicum L.) under a Hydroponic Wick System Muhammad Fahri Rizaldi; Ramdan Hidayat; Hadi Suhardjono

Abstract

Shallots (Allium ascalonicum L.) are cultivated as a high economic value agricultural business. Cutting the tip of the seed bulb can stimulate, accelerate and synchronize plant growth. In hydroponic cultivation, the volume of planting media is an important component that needs to be considered. This research was conducted at the Greenhouse Hydroponic Farm Lamongan, Lamongan District, Lamongan Regency, East Java. Split plot design (RPT) or split plot design in a Completely Randomized Design (CRD) with the main plot (main plot) the volume of planting media (U) with 3 levels: 10cm (U1), 15cm (U2), 20cm (U3) and sub plots (sub plots) are the size of the cutting of the seed bulbs (P) with 4 levels: not cut (P0), cut 1/4 (P1), cut 1/3 (P2), cut 1/2 (P3). It was found that the treatment of the size of the cutting of the seed bulbs affected the vegetative and generative variables. Meanwhile, the treatment of planting media volume affects generative variables, especially on the number of harvested bulbs per box and the weight of harvested bulbs per box. The most optimal interaction between the combination of the size of cutting seed bulbs and the volume of planting media occurs at the size of cutting seed bulbs of 1/4 part and the volume of planting media of 10 cm, which is able to increase the weight of harvested bulbs per clump.
Physical and Physiological Quality of Rice Seeds of Inpari 32 Variety Under Different Harvest Ages, Packaging Types, and Storage Durations Arif Fathoni; Ramdan Hidayat; Juli Santoso

Abstract

This study aimed to determine the optimal harvest time and packaging type to preserve the quality of Inpari 32 rice seeds during storage. Conducted at the Food and Horticultural Plant Seed Supervision and Certification Unit in East Java from November 2023 to April 2024, the research used a factorial experiment in a completely randomized design (CRD) with three replications. Harvest age treatments were 110, 120, 130, and 140 days after seedling (DAS), while packaging types included plastic sacks, polyethylene (PE) sacks, polypropylene (PP) sacks, and aluminium foil. Data were analyzed using ANOVA and Duncan's Multiple Range Test (DMRT) at a 5% significance level. Results showed that harvesting at 120 DAS with PP sacks yielded the highest starch content, while 140 DAS with aluminium foil resulted in the lowest reducing sugar content. Optimal germination and growth speed were achieved at 130 DAS, which also minimized electrical conductivity. Harvesting at 140 DAS produced the highest 1000-grain weight. Aluminium foil packaging maintained the lowest moisture content and significantly improved germination and growth speed compared to other packaging types. These findings suggest that optimizing harvest age and packaging type can significantly improve seed viability and storage performance.
The Effect of Planting Media and Nutrient Flow on the Growth of Hydroponic Lettuce with the NFT System Ahyaniah Dewi Syabarina; Ramdan Hidayat; Didik Utomo Pribadi

Abstract

Lettuce is a type of vegetable plant that is consumed by the wide community. Hydroponic lettuce cultivation has become an alternative as land area decreases as a result of land-use conversion. This research aims to determine lettuce growth which is influenced by the type of planting media and nutrient discharge. This study was conducted at the Greenhouse Emak Farm and Hidroponik Wadungasri, Waru District, Sidoarjo Regency, East Java, adopting a Split Plot Design with the main plot of nutrient solution discharge (L) consisting of 3 levels, namely L1 = 1.5 L/min; L2 = 2 L/min; L3 = 2.5 L/min. The subplot is the planting media (M) consisting of 4 types, namely M₁ = rockwool; M₂ = rice husk charcoal; M₃ = cocopeat; M₄ = fern. The observed variables comprised leaf number, leaf area, plant height, stem diameter, total plant biomass, stem and leaf biomass, root biomass, harvest index, and plant age. The results indicated that the combination of fern-based growing media and a nutrient solution flow rate of 1.5 L/min produced the most favorable outcomes for all measured parameters, with the exception of the harvest index. Nutrient flow rate of 1.5 L/min was recommended for hydroponic using fern growing media.
Growth and Yield Response of Sunflower (Helianthus annuus L.) Plants to Paclobutrazol Dosage and Application Time Fitriyah Fitriyah; Ramdan Hidayat; Widiwurjani Widiwurjani

Abstract

Sunflower (Hellianthus annuus L.) has high economic value due to its great potential in industry. High market demand causes the need for intensification in sunflower cultivation to increase production and seed quality. This study aims to determine the right dosage and time of paclobutrazol application in suppressing growth and increasing the yield of sunflower plants. The research was conducted in Dohoagung Village, Balongpanggang District, Gresik Regency from May to September 2024. This research used a Factorial Completely Randomized Design (CRD) with 2 factors, namely dose and application time. The two treatments resulted in 12 combinations, each of which was repeated three times. The results of the analysis of variance were further tested with the 5% HSD test.  The results show that the combination of paclobutrazol dosage of 0.3 g/plant and application time of 4 WAP gives the best results on plant growth (plant height and stem diameter). The single treatment of paclobutrazol dosage of 0.2 g/plant gave the best results on flower diameter, number of seeds, total seed weight and 100 seed weight. A single treatment of paclobutrazol application time at 4 WAP produced the best plant growth and increased flower diameter.
Phenological Stage Application of Gibberellin to Enhance Fruit Quality of Melon (Cucumis melo ‘Fujisawa’) under NFT Hydroponic System Hidayat, Ramdan; Fasya, Elfira Rizki Oktaviana; Nugrahani, Pangesti; Zakiyah, Nur Meili

Abstract

National melon production remains suboptimal due to the crop’s sensitivity to the environment and lack of management practices. This study analyzed the interaction between GA₃ concentration (0, 50, 100, 150 ppm) and application timing (pre-anthesis, anthesis, post-anthesis) on growth, yield, and fruit quality of Fujisawa melon in an NFT hydroponic system. Significant concentration × timing interactions (p<0.05) optimized fruit traits at 100 ppm + anthesis: weight increased by 0.49 kg (24.1%) to 2.03 kg, flesh thickness by 1.33 cm (25.7%) to 5.17 cm, diameter by 1.79 cm (10.9%) to 16.38 cm, and volume by 413 cm³ (21.2%) to 1,950 cm³ vs. control. Regardless of timing, 100 ppm GA₃ accelerated flowering (2.71 days) and harvest (3.87 days) vs. control and increased total soluble solids by 2.33 to 16.33ºBrix. Pre-anthesis application enhanced plant length by 8.57–9.41 cm and hastened flowering by 0.87–0.99 days compared to other timings. Leaf number and fruit cavity were unaffected by either treatment (p>0.05). The regression for fruit traits at anthesis (R²=0.74–0.85) confirmed optimum concentrations of 67.50–138.50 ppm; ≥150 ppm diminished benefits. These findings provide recommendations: 100 ppm GA₃ at anthesis maximizes yield components, 75 ppm at flexible times increases sweetness levels.
Synergystic Role of Cocopeat Matrix and Foliar Nutrient Type on Aclimatization Success of Micropropagated Dendrobium Seedlings Baharuddin Mohammad Luthfi; Ramdan Hidayat; Pangesti Nugrahani

Abstract

Background: Dendrobium orchids have high economic value (in 2020 generated an export value of US$61.87 thousand), yet micropropagated seedlings commonly exhibit slow growth and high mortality during the acclimatization stage. This problem is largely associated with the use of unsuitable planting media and inadequate nutrient supply, which limit seedling adaptation and survival after tissue culture. This study aims to determine the best combination of planting media and foliar fertilizer types for the growth of Dendrobium orchid seedlings during the acclimatization stage. Methodology: The study was conducted in Penambangan Village, Semanding District, Tuban Regency, East Java Province from November 2024 to February 2025 using a Completely Randomized Design (CRD) with 9 treatment combinations and 4 replications. The first factor was the treatment of planting media types (M1: Black Moss, M2: Rice Husk Charcoal, M3: Cocopeat), and the second factor was the type of foliar fertilizer (P1: Gandasil D, P2: Gaviota 63, P3: Grow Quick LB). The observed research variables included the percentage of live seedlings, plant height, leaf area, seedling growth rate, number of shoots, and number of roots. Findings: The results showed that the use of cocopeat planting media resulted in the highest percentage of seedling survival at 88.33%. The combination of cocopeat planting media and Grow Quick LB leaf fertilizer produced the best relative growth rate (RGR) at 8-12 WAP of 41.22 mg/month.This research produces the best combination of planting media and foliar fertilizer for orchid seedlings at the acclimatization stage. Contribution: The findings contribute to a more systematic understanding of how substrate physical properties and foliar nutrient supply interact to influence survival and growth performance during orchid acclimatization, offering a scientifically grounded framework for improving ex vitro propagation efficiency
Morfologi dan Anatomi Bibit Alpukat Sambungan pada Stadia tumbuh Entres dan Metode Sambung Pucuk Da Costa, Antonia Jessica Sherlyn; Hidayat, Ramdan; Santoso, Juli

Abstract

Avocado is a fruit crop that is commercial and potential to be widely cultivated. Market demand for avocado was increased so production of avocado seed must increase too by grafting. The problem of grafting is often found in the connection between scion and rootstock that showed like elephant foot phenomenon, so it was necessary to study the linkage process between scion and rootstock. This research leads up to an increased percentage of finished graft seedlings that were ready for planting in the field. This method used a factorial experiment consisting of 2 factors. The first factor was the stages of entres (flushing, endodormancy, and ecodormancy), and the second factor was the grafting method (cleft graft, wedge graft, and splice graft). The research design used Complete Randomized Design with 4 replications and ANOVA with BNJ 5% test. The results showed all observations parameters interacted. Stage ecodormancy in splice graft resulted of vascular tissue (xylem and phloem) between scion and rootstock recovered better than other combination treatments by producing the best-grafted avocado seedlings growth with an increased percentage of grafted seedling by 42.50%, an interval of flushing by 4.91 days, and increased frequency of flushing by 1.83 times compared to stage flushing in cleft graft.

Abstract

Empowerment of Sumber Abadi Forest Farmer Groups through Innovation of Porang Nursery Techniques. Forest Farmers Group (FFG) Sumber Abadi is located in Panglungan Village, Wonosalam District, Jombang Regency, whose area is 500-750 m asl and daily temperature of 20° C. The conditions of socio-economic need to be improved, considering that their livelihoods depend on forest products and half of the population belongs to the category of pre-prosperous families. Panglungan village has the largest porang area and has the potential for a profitable porang seed business, encouraging farmers to carry out traditional nurseries to fulfill the increasing demand for seeds. Porang is a super strategic commodity and prospectus as a healthy food, low carbohydrates and high fiber, and a high tuber selling price (Rp 10,000,-/kg). Obstacles in the porang nursery business in Panglungan Village, namely: (1) lack of understanding of proper nursery techniques, (2) weak innovation of porang nurseries, (3) lack of understanding of seed supply chain management, and (4) weak of institutional functioning. The aim of the activity is to increase empowerment through innovative porang nursery techniques. Empowerment methods include: (1) training on innovation in porang nursery technology on various seed sources, (2) demonstration plots for porang nurseries, (3) economic empowerment of rural communities, (4) training on marketing porang seeds online. The results of the empowerment of FFG Sumber Abadi showed that there were 2 groups of porang seed breeders who were innovative in seeding techniques and marketing with a volume of more than 2 million seeds that lasted for 5 months.
